What Is Mobile Welding in Lambeth?

On-site mobile welding work in Lambeth SE1

Mobile welding means bringing the full workshop to your location – including welding machines, generator, cutting tools, consumables and safety equipment. This avoids dismantling beams, moving heavy steel or arranging transport for vehicles and machinery.

Our mobile welding service in Lambeth covers urgent repairs on beams, architectural metalwork, vehicle chassis reinforcement and general fabrication. We work from structural engineer drawings, architect plans or clear photos and measurements you provide.

How Welded Beam Reinforcement Jobs Are Carried Out Safely

Welding produces heat, sparks and fumes, so every Lambeth job is approached with strict safety protocols. Protecting people, property and vehicles is our priority before starting any welding.

We assess the site, shield glass and paintwork, manage cables safely, and use full PPE including helmets, gloves and jackets. Our goal is strong, neat welds with controlled risk and a clean, safe site on completion.

Welding Safety Checklist

  • ✓ Site risk assessment and safety checks before work begins
  • ✓ Fire watch and fire extinguisher on hand throughout welding
  • ✓ Protection of nearby glass, vehicles, paintwork and delicate surfaces
  • ✓ Proper earthing, cable routing and lead management
  • ✓ PPE including welding helmet, gloves, jacket, boots and eye protection
  • ✓ Clean-up of debris, spatter and visual inspection of welds afterwards

5. What metals can you weld?

We mainly weld mild and structural steel. Depending on access and the job type, we can also weld stainless steel and aluminium – for example, architectural railings, furniture and vehicle parts.

6. Do I need to provide power?

Standard 240V power on-site is helpful but not essential. We can bring our own generator – just let us know in advance so we can plan the set-up and quote correctly.

7. Can you weld outdoors?

Yes, we often weld outside, but we need safe conditions. Heavy rain and strong winds can affect weld quality and safety, so we may advise rescheduling or using shelters where possible.

15. Will welding damage nearby glass or paint?

Sparks can mark glass and paintwork if not controlled, so we always protect surrounding areas where possible. Please move vehicles and valuables out of the immediate welding area before we start.

16. Can you paint after welding?

We can apply primer or basic paint to welded areas if requested as an optional extra. Full decorative painting or colour-matching is usually better handled separately once the metal has cooled and been prepared.

17. Do you issue any paperwork for structural jobs?

We can confirm in writing what welding work was carried out, but structural sign-off always remains with your structural engineer and the building control officer.
